Lijith Gopalakrishna Pillai is listed as G Metallurgist at Vault Minerals, a with 336 employees, based in Willetton, Western Australia, Australia. AeroLeads shows a matched LinkedIn profile for Lijith Gopalakrishna Pillai.

Lijith Gopalakrishna Pillai previously worked as Mining Lab at Intertek and Senior Process Engineer - Acid Regeneration Plant at The Kerala Minerals & Metals Limited. Lijith Gopalakrishna Pillai holds B Tech, Chemical Engineering, First Class With Distinction from Anna University Chennai.

Profile bio

About Lijith Gopalakrishna Pillai

I am a dedicated and accomplished Senior Process Engineer with a comprehensive background in driving operational excellence and process optimization within the manufacturing industry. Throughout my career, I have achieved proven success in leading cross-functional teams and implementing innovative solutions to enhance production efficiency, reduce costs, and ensure compliance with industry standards. My specialized expertise spans a range of plant operations, including acid regeneration, ilmenite ore beneficiation, chlorination, oxidation, and pigment finishing.I excel in identifying and mitigating process bottlenecks, resulting in significant reductions in downtime and improved overall production output. My track record includes successful project leadership in commissioning and process improvement initiatives, consistently delivering projects within established timelines and budgetary constraints. With strong analytical and problem-solving skills, I leverage data-driven insights and technical expertise to optimize processes. I am recognized for proficiency in planning, scheduling, and executing operations to maintain high standards of quality and efficiency. My commitment to driving continuous improvement and operational excellence positions me as a valuable asset in any manufacturing environment.Bachelor of Chemical Engineering , awarded in December 2008, assessed by Engineers Australia as equivalent to an AQF Bachelor Degree. Recognized as a Professional Engineer (Chemical Engineer) with ANZSCO Code 233111 and Skill Level 1, with relevant overseas skilled employment from October 2009.

Project Engineer/Operations – Synthetic Rutile Plant

Kollam, Kerala, India

Spearheaded the successful oversight of the erection, site commissioning, and ramp-up of the capacity augmentation for the Synthetic Rutile Plant, ensuring strict adherence to safety and quality standards, and elevating production capacity from 35,000 MT/year to 55,000 MT/year. Led the dynamic implementation of the Distributed Control System (DCS) in the existing plant, markedly improving process control and operational efficiency. Prioritised and enforced comprehensive safety measures across all project activities, safeguarding the well-being of team members and ensuring full compliance with safety regulations. Conducted meticulous HAZOP and diverse risk assessment activities and workshops to proactively identify and mitigate potential hazards. Assumed responsibility for reviewing designs, calculations, vendor data, and study documents, demonstrating a keen eye for detail and precision. Orchestrated seamless coordination with specialised consultants and sub-consultants to address design elements specific to the process, ensuring a cohesive and integrated approach. Developed and adhered to meticulously crafted project timelines and budgets, consistently tracking progress and ensuring on-time and within-budget project completions. Facilitated transparent communication and collaboration among diverse project stakeholders, fostering alignment between internal teams, contractors, and management to uphold project coherence. Maintained meticulous project documentation, including plans, reports, and records, ensuring a comprehensive and accurate repository of project activities. Demonstrated a proactive approach in addressing and resolving project-related issues, challenges, and deviations during the execution phase, concurrently identifying avenues for process optimisation, efficiency improvements, and cost savings within the project scope.

Feb 2010 - Jun 2012
